"Vivian, marriage is not a game."
Tristan Sterling’s expression was grim as he spoke coolly.
"But she isn’t a proper wife! You were injured, and she didn’t care about you at all. I can’t see a single trace of love for you in her eyes. Tristan, you deserve better!" ’Like me!’
Vivian Linton cried out indignantly, her face a mask of injustice on his behalf.
She desperately wanted to shout those last two words, but she was afraid it would be too forward and disgust him, so she held her tongue.
A glint of coldness flashed in Tristan Sterling’s eyes.
’She doesn’t have a trace of love for me anymore?’
He refused to believe it.
’The Holly Sinclair of the past loved him so much. How could she just stop loving him on a whim?’
’She’s just throwing a tantrum, that’s why she’s pretending to be indifferent to me.’
Tristan Sterling was very confident in his own charm.
He even felt that it didn’t matter if the current Holly Sinclair truly didn’t love him anymore.
He had plenty of ways to make her fall in love with him again.
Looking at Tristan Sterling’s calm face, Vivian Linton realized her attempt to sow discord had failed.
She was shocked and flustered.
’Why aren’t my words working on him anymore?’
He—
Tears rolled down her cheeks as she sobbed and pleaded, "Tristan, I’m begging you, please divorce Holly Sinclair, okay?"
"I’ll say it one more time. The only Mrs. Sterling will be Holly Sinclair."
A hint of impatience crossed the man’s eyes, his tone deepening.
"Then what about me? What am I supposed to do?"
Vivian Linton broke down, screaming, "I love you, Tristan! You said you’d be responsible for me! Are you starting to despise me? Do you think that because I’m missing a leg, I’m not good enough for you?"
"Vivian!"
Tristan Sterling snapped.
The atmosphere turned icy.
Vivian Linton froze, her face turning pale.
’Tristan is angry.’
’He’s angry that I’m trying to guilt him with what I did for him.’
Yes.
She had done it on purpose.
She deliberately brought up her missing leg to remind him that she became disabled saving his life.
In the past, whenever she brought it up, he would feel guilty and his heart would ache for her.
But today...
He was just displeased.
Vivian Linton was an expert at reading a situation.
Seeing that things were going south, she quickly put on a hurt and aggrieved expression, choking back sobs as she apologized. "I’m sorry, Tristan. I didn’t mean to make you angry. I just... I just feel so wronged. I’ve waited for you for so long. If you don’t want me, what am I supposed to do...?"
She looked at him with tear-filled eyes, humbling herself completely.
And sure enough!
Seeing her crying so pitifully, Tristan Sterling couldn’t bear it. His expression softened. "I’ve told you before, aside from marriage, I will do my best to give you anything you want."
"Tristan, will you really be responsible for me for the rest of my life?"
"Of course."
This was his promise to her.
A promise bought with her life-saving sacrifice.
"Tristan, thank you." Vivian Linton shed tears of gratitude, deciding to quit while she was ahead.
But inwardly, she was thinking viciously, ’Since Tristan won’t budge, I’ll have to find a way to break through that bitch Holly Sinclair.’
’I refuse to believe I can’t tear them apart!’
’In any case, the position of Mrs. Sterling will be mine.’
’Anyone who dares to stand in my way...’
’...will die!’
...
Tristan Sterling was as good as his word. The next day, he actually went with Holly Sinclair to the Civil Affairs Bureau to refill their divorce application.
And so began another one-month cooling-off period.
For the next half a month, the two had no contact whatsoever.
Although the divorce wasn’t going smoothly, her studio’s business was booming.
Sunday, 7:00 PM.
Holly Sinclair arrived at The Banyon Hotel.
Sonia Sutton was already waiting for her at the main entrance.
"Sonia."
Holly Sinclair walked over quickly to meet her.
"Is the qipao finished?" Sonia asked.
"It is." Holly Sinclair slightly raised the exquisite paper bag in her hand.
Inside was a magnificent qipao she had spent a week creating.
A week ago, Sonia had introduced her to a client.
This client was very generous and was also very satisfied with her design.
The client was very influential and didn’t appear in person; Holly only communicated with the client’s assistant.
The assistant indicated that if this collaboration went well, they would establish a long-term partnership with SH Studio.
Holly Sinclair was overjoyed.
Having her designs recognized gave her a great sense of accomplishment.
"Thank you, Sonia."
Holly Sinclair was sincerely grateful.
Sonia was three years older than her and was genuinely good to her, having introduced her to many clients, both big and small.
"What’s there to thank me for?" Sonia said. "If it weren’t for you, I’d still be getting played for a fool by that scumbag and his mistress. Plus, you saved my life. If anyone should be saying thank you, it’s me."
Sonia had a straightforward personality; she loved fiercely and hated passionately.
If someone was one part good to her, she would be ten parts good to them in return.
Holly had not only helped her see her treacherous "best friend" for who she was, but had also saved her from a runaway horse. Naturally, she had to repay her kindness.
The two of them walked into the hotel together.
"By the way, your client this time is Miss Evelyn Morgan, the fourth daughter of the Morgan Family from Oakhaven. Have you heard of her?" Sonia asked.
"No." Holly Sinclair shook her head.
She knew of the Morgan Family; they were the richest family in Oakhaven.
But she didn’t know anything about Miss Morgan.
"Then let me give you a heads-up," Sonia warned. "This Miss Morgan is the apple of the Morgan Family’s eye. She’s arrogant, domineering, and rather difficult to deal with. Be careful when you meet her in a bit."
"Okay, I understand." Holly Sinclair nodded lightly.
In truth, she was already mentally prepared.
Miss Morgan’s assistant had been extremely picky when discussing the design details with her.
But the customer is always right.
Money isn’t that easy to earn.
Evelyn Morgan had come to Mistcroft this time for an arranged blind date set up by her family.
Tonight, the largest banquet hall in The Banyon Hotel was magnificently decorated for a welcome party Miss Morgan was hosting for herself.
She had invited numerous socialites and young masters from Mistcroft’s high society.
Sonia had an invitation, and Holly followed her into the banquet hall.
Holly Sinclair felt like her eyes were cursed.
The moment she walked in, she spotted a familiar figure in the crowd.
Tristan Sterling.
And...
Vivian Linton, clinging to his arm.
...
Meanwhile, Tristan Sterling suddenly got a phone call and stepped away to answer it.
Left alone, Vivian Linton happily basked in everyone’s envy and praise.
"Miss Linton, you and Mr. Sterling make such a perfect couple."
"Yes, yes! You two seem so close. Are wedding bells in the near future?"
"Miss Linton, when you become Madam Sterling, don’t forget about us."
A few socialites surrounded Vivian Linton, showering her with compliments.
"Don’t you worry. We’re all good friends. Of course I’ll remember you all when good things come my way."
Vivian Linton smiled insincerely, her heart soaring from all the flattery. Her vanity was immensely satisfied.
’It’s a good thing Tristan went to take that call.’
’If Tristan were here, I wouldn’t be able to enjoy this kind of prestige and glory.’
Because no one would dare say such things in front of Mr. Sterling.
"Miss Linton, I heard that Miss Morgan absolutely loves the qipao you designed and that you’re going to be her personal designer from now on. Is that true?"
One of the socialites suddenly changed the subject, her tone even more envious.
In the eyes of outsiders, Vivian Linton was not only the apple of Mr. Sterling’s eye but also an outstanding designer in the world of qipao—a true winner in life.
"How did you know?"
Vivian Linton feigned surprise, then covered her mouth as if she had misspoken. "Oh my, look at my big mouth. Miss Morgan hasn’t even announced it yet. You all shouldn’t be guessing wildly..."
